Polynesian navigators settled islands scattered across an ocean expanse larger than North America using no instruments at all — steering by star paths, bird flight lines, and ocean swells so subtle that some wayfinders read them by feel through the hull of the canoe.

Navigation is the craft of knowing where you are and holding a course when no landmark is visible — combining direction (compass or star bearings), position (latitude from the height of the sun or Pole Star), and bookkeeping (dead reckoning of speed, heading, and time). Chinese texts record magnetized needles guiding ships by around 1090–1119, the first instrument that points reliably in cloud and darkness. Charts, sailing directions, and astronomical tables turned individual seamen's memory into transferable, cumulative knowledge.

Without navigation, the ocean is a wall; with it, the ocean becomes a road. Coastal sailors had always crept from headland to headland, but the compass and chart let ships cut straight across open water in any season, making voyages faster, cargoes cheaper, and rendezvous possible — strangers finding each other on purpose in a featureless sea. Longitude remained the deadly gap for centuries, killing fleets on unexpected coasts, until John Harrison's marine chronometer in the 1760s let sailors carry home's time with them and fix east-west position at last.

The mariner's compass began as a magnetized needle — stroked with a lodestone — floating on a straw or pivoting on a pin, later boxed with a wind-rose card. Latitude came from measuring the Pole Star or noon sun with quadrant, astrolabe, or cross-staff and consulting simple tables; distance run came from a log line paid out over the stern and a sandglass. The navigator's arithmetic — courses, speeds, and times compounded into a position — is why number systems and tables sit beneath the whole practice.

Reliable navigation opened ocean trade routes, deep-sea fishing, and the age of exploration with all its commerce and catastrophe — the Columbian exchange, global empires, and the first truly worldwide economy. It drove precision instrument-making and astronomy for centuries, since better clocks and star tables meant fewer wrecks. Its lineage runs unbroken from the floating needle to gyrocompasses, inertial guidance, and GPS.

A magnetized iron needle floated on water in a bowl for direction, the Pole Star's height above the horizon for latitude, and careful dead reckoning — speed times time on each heading — marked on a chart.
